Seminar- Leading Economically Resilient Communities: What Public Officials Need to Prioritize Before & After a Major Economic Disruption
Tags | Disaster Preparedness | Leadership | News & Resources
- Learn how to closely partner with chambers of commerce, economic development organizations, and other business groups to effectively communicate with the private sector after a major event;
- Discover the business support services which are critical for fortifying local businesses against disruption and retaining them after a disaster;
- Learn how other communities have successfully leveraged federal and private sector resources for rebuilding efforts;
- Become familiar with public policies that can be put in place during blue skies to better facilitate and expedite economic recovery after a disaster strikes.
- Better understand your role as a community leader in spurring business preparedness and economic recovery within your community.
